What Are Car Key Services?

Car key services encompass a variety of tasks associated with automobile keys, consisting of:

  1. Key Duplication: Making copies of existing keys for spare usage.
  2. Key Replacement: Creating new keys when originals are lost or harmed.
  3. Key Programming: Configuring transponder keys and key fobs to deal with a vehicle's immobilizer system.
  4. Ignition Repair and Replacement: Handling concerns connected to malfunctioning ignitions or changing the ignition system totally.
  5. Emergency Situation Lockout Services: Assisting people who are locked out of their lorries.

Kinds Of Car Keys

Before diving deeper into car key services, it's vital to understand the different types of keys that modern-day cars use:

Key TypeDescription
Traditional KeyEasy metal keys that operate mechanical locks.
Transponder KeyIncludes a chip that interacts with the vehicle's ignition to prevent theft.
Remote Key FobKeyless entry devices that allow drivers to unlock and start their vehicle without inserting a key.
Smart KeyAdvanced innovation that can begin the vehicle with distance detection and push-button ignition.

When to Seek Car Key Services

Comprehending when to require car key services is essential for every vehicle owner. Here are some situations that generally require a professional's assistance:

  1. Lost or Stolen Keys: If keys are lost or stolen, it is essential to have actually replacements made immediately for security reasons.
  2. Harmed Keys: Keys can end up being worn or broken gradually, making it challenging to run the vehicle.
  3. Vehicle Lockouts: Getting locked out of a car can happen to anybody, and emergency situation lockout services can rapidly solve the scenario.
  4. Malfunctioning Keys: If a key or remote stops working to work properly, it may require reprogramming or replacement.
  5. Altering Locks: After a theft or a sale, new locks and keys might be needed for enhanced security.

How to Choose the Right Car Key Service Provider

With various choices offered, choosing a trustworthy car key service company can be daunting. Here are some key factors to consider:

  1. Reputation: Look for business with favorable client reviews and testimonials.
  2. Services Offered: Ensure the supplier provides the particular services you need, such as key programs or ignition repair.
  3. Experience: Check for how long the company has stayed in business and their specialists' proficiency.
  4. Pricing: Request quotes from numerous service suppliers to compare costs for the services you require.
  5. Availability: Look for a provider that uses emergency services and is offered 24/7.

Common Car Key Issues and Solutions

Here's a table showing some of the typical car key problems vehicle owners face and the possible solutions readily available:

IssueSolution
Lost KeyKey replacement through a locksmith or dealer.
Broken KeyKey repair or duplication of a new key.
Ignition ProblemsIgnition repair or complete replacement.
Remote Not WorkingBattery replacement or reprogramming the remote.
Key Fob IssuesReprogramming or acquiring a new key fob.

FAQs About Car Key Services

  1. What is the typical expense of car key replacement?

    • The cost can differ commonly depending on the type of key. Traditional keys may begin around ₤ 2-5, while transponder keys can range from ₤ 70 to ₤ 250, and clever keys can surpass ₤ 300.
  2. How long does it require to replace a car key?

    • Normally, it can take anywhere from 10 minutes for a simple key duplication to over an hour for more intricate key programs or ignition concerns.
  3. Can I configure my own key?

    • Some car owners can set their own keys by following specific procedures in the vehicle's manual. Nevertheless, advanced keys typically require expert devices.
  4. What should I do if my key gets stuck in the ignition?

    • Try carefully wiggling the key while turning it. If it doesn't budge, think about getting in touch with a professional to prevent damaging the ignition.
